pellets for horses are typically made from a mixture of grains, vitamins, and minerals that are compressed into small, uniform pellets. They provide a concentrated source of nutrition that is easy to digest and can be fed alone or mixed with other types of feed. Pellets come in a variety of formulations to meet the specific dietary needs of different horses, including those that are high in fiber for horses with digestive issues or low in sugar for horses that are prone to metabolic issues.
One of the key benefits of feeding pellets to horses is that they offer a consistent and balanced source of nutrition. Unlike some traditional feeds, such as hay or grain, which can vary in quality and nutritional content, pellets are manufactured to provide a precise blend of nutrients in every bite. This ensures that your horse is getting the vitamins, minerals, and protein they need to maintain optimal health and performance.
Pellets are also easy to store and transport, making them a convenient option for busy horse owners or those who travel frequently with their horses. Pellets have a long shelf life and can be purchased in bulk, reducing the need for frequent trips to the feed store. They can also be easily portioned out and fed in controlled amounts, which can help prevent overfeeding and weight gain in horses that are prone to obesity.
Another benefit of pellets for horses is that they can help improve digestion and reduce the risk of digestive issues such as colic. Pellets are designed to be easily broken down in the horse’s digestive tract, making them a more digestible option than whole grains or hay. This can help reduce the risk of impaction colic and other digestive disorders that can be caused by poorly digested feed.
In addition to their nutritional benefits, pellets can also be a cost-effective option for feeding horses. While pellets may initially seem more expensive than traditional feeds, they can actually be more economical in the long run. Because pellets are a concentrated source of nutrients, horses require less feed overall to meet their daily nutritional needs. This can help reduce feed costs and waste, making pellets a cost-effective option for maintaining your horse’s health.
When choosing pellets for your horse, it’s important to look for high-quality options that are formulated to meet the specific needs of your horse. Different horses have different nutritional requirements based on factors such as age, activity level, and overall health, so it’s essential to choose a pellet formula that is tailored to your horse’s individual needs. It’s also important to follow feeding instructions carefully and consult with your veterinarian or equine nutritionist if you have any questions or concerns about feeding pellets to your horse.
